The Psychology of Colour in Gaming

The implementation of colour psychology in game design is a advanced science, carefully employed to shape player perception and behaviour. Colours are not perceived in a vacuum; they carry cultural meanings and evoke fundamental emotional responses that can influence excitement, trust, and the perceived value of an experience. In the cutthroat UK iGaming market, where player attention is a valuable commodity, developers leverage this knowledge to craft instant connections. The strategic use of colour can signal risk, reward, luxury, or action, often before a single spin has been taken, setting the entire tone for the gameplay journey that follows.

For slot games specifically, colour schemes are designed to maintain engagement and reinforce thematic elements. Warm tones might accelerate the feeling of anticipation, while cooler shades could provide a sense of calm or reliability. The contrast between background colours and symbol hues is crucial for clarity and visual impact during fast-paced play. Understanding this foundational principle allows us to appreciate the nuanced choices made in titles like Coin Strike Slot, where the palette is carefully curated to align with both its theme and its desired psychological effect on players across the United Kingdom.

Societal Colour Meanings in the UK Context

While basic colour psychology provides a foundation, cultural context brings a critical layer of meaning. The UK has its own unique set of associations with colours, shaped by history, sport, and even national symbolism. Designers of games focusing on this market are often mindful of these nuances. For instance, the combination of red, white, and blue conveys immediate national connotations, which can be utilised to foster familiarity or a sense of localised appeal. Coin Strike Slot’s use of a regal gold and stable blue can subconsciously echo themes of quality and tradition that align with British values of heritage and fair play.

Furthermore, colours associated with luck and fortune can change. While red is considered lucky in many East Asian cultures, in the UK, it’s more directly linked to danger, passion, and, in gaming, high-stakes action. The game’s palette cleverly steers these cultural touchpoints by using red for excitement rather than relying on it as a primary luck symbol, instead positioning that role firmly on gold—a colour whose association with money is virtually universal. This culturally-aware design guarantees the game communicates effectively and positively with its intended audience without relying on potentially ambiguous symbolism.

Visual Contrast and Design Hierarchy in Casino Game Design

Beyond emotional triggers, the functional implementation of colour in Coin Strike Slot is a textbook example in creating well-defined visual order and focus. Effective contrast is the idea that makes the most important elements impossible to ignore. The game employs high-contrast pairings, such as luminous gold symbols against a deeper blue or black background, guaranteeing that coins, the game’s namesake feature, are the obvious stars of the show. This directs the player’s gaze right away to the sources of potential wins, simplifying the experience and boosting excitement when those symbols align.

This systematic use of contrast also aids in usability and reduces player fatigue. By colour-coding different functional areas—perhaps blue for informational panels, gold for value displays, and red for interactive controls—the game creates an natural map that players can navigate automatically. For a UK player, who may be playing a quick session during a commute or in the evening, this clarity is vital. It allows for instant immersion without a steep learning curve, making the game both user-friendly and visually thrilling, where every spin is a vivid and colourful event.
